As the FTTP products do run at the rated speed, not "up to", I suppose there may be an issue at times of heavy demand, as they will hit the pipes at full speed, not the FTTC assortment of speeds.
No reason that would be any more of a problem for FTPP realistically.
This applies particularly to things like Apple IOS downloads or a new blockbuster film coming online. FTTP users will go at full speed. Congestion for all users could be caused. It would be OTT to provide extra bandwidth at the nodes for the purpose, and unacceptable to allow the congestion. A rock and a hard place for the ISPs.
In reality very few events make a noticeable difference because people vary. Your household may have six iPhone, the neighbours have none. You watch the world cup avidly, next door they're only interested in Wimbledon, and so on. Apple doesn't have infinite bandwidth either, so they will stagger the iOS availability (as do Microsoft for Windows, Google for Nexus Android updates, and so on)
There will be exceptional things that cause congestion but a properly managed backhaul will see only rare hiccups, and customers shrug those off.
For WBC the backhaul isn't even the ISP's problem, it's supplied with the service, they only have to buy enough transit bandwidth, and if they can't manage that then they're probably also going to struggle with logistics like billing and remembering which shoe goes on which foot. Of course choosing not to manage it properly to save money is another matter as the US ISPs have illustrated.

As to why many ISPs don't offer it: My theory would be it's because it's a minority product; bigger companies can't support minority products well because they like to train all customer service people identically and then treat them as interchangeable. Training fifty people about FTTP would be a waste (so few customers have it, many agents would never take a call that used the training) but training Bob about it but not Sarah means that when a customer calls Sarah and the screen says "Customer has FTTP" she has to know to forward to Bob, assuming he's even in today.
If you're A&A this doesn't matter, small team, everybody knows the deal, if something comes up that one person doesn't know about they've a good idea who to pass it to, and they can banjo if they need to. But if you're a bigger firm it's a nightmare. If the UK had a million potential FTTP customers, they'd all fall over themselves, but if it's more like 5000 why even bother?
